.NET Developer with SQL

4 Hours ago • 8 Years +

Job Summary

Job Description

You will be responsible for managing technology in projects and providing technical guidance and solutions. Responsibilities include providing technical guidance, ensuring process compliance, preparing status reports, and developing quality software. The role requires systematic architecture, design, and programming skills, attention to detail, and collaboration with development and project managers. The candidate should be able to design, code, test, and support software components, analyze problems, and maintain system documentation. The candidate should also act as a second line of support during production problems.
Must have:
  • Bachelor's degree in Computer Science or related field.
  • 8+ years of experience in .NET technologies and C#.
  • Experience with database systems and SQL queries.
  • Familiarity with microservices architecture.
  • Solid understanding of web development best practices.
  • Strong problem-solving skills and attention to detail.
  • Excellent communication and collaboration skills.
  • Ability to work effectively in a fast-paced environment.
  • Passionate about full-stack development.
Good to have:
  • N/A

Job Details

Project description

You will be responsible for managing technology in projects and providing technical guidance and solutions for work completion.
(1.) To be responsible for providing technical guidance and solutions.
(2.) To ensure process compliance in the assigned module and participate in technical discussions and reviews.
(3.) To prepare and submit status reports for minimizing exposure and risks on the project or closure of escalations.
(4.) Being self-organized, focused on developing on time and quality software.

Responsibilities
bullet icon

Demonstrate a systematic and disciplined architecture, system design, and programming approach following a standard software development lifecycle

bullet icon

Meticulous attention to detail and strong focus on clear and practical documentation

bullet icon

Work closely with development manager, Project Manager, and a team of developers

bullet icon

Design, Code, Unit Test, and support software components

bullet icon

Deliver quality software in a timely manner following standard software development processes

bullet icon

Analyze problems raised in software development or production environments and provide timely solutions

bullet icon

Develop, prepare, and maintain system documentation, including program descriptions, operational procedures, etc.

bullet icon

Act as the second line of support during production problems

Skills

Must have

bullet icon

Bachelor's degree in Computer Science, Engineering, or a related field.

bullet icon

Proven 8+ years of experience as a full-stack developer with expertise in .NET technologies and C#.

bullet icon

Experience with database systems, especially with writing complex SQL queries.

bullet icon

Familiarity with microservices architecture and its implementation.

bullet icon

Solid understanding of web development best practices, design patterns, and architecture.

bullet icon

Strong problem-solving skills and attention to detail.

bullet icon

Excellent communication and collaboration skills.

bullet icon

Ability to work effectively in a fast-paced and dynamic environment.

bullet icon

If you are passionate about full-stack development and possess the required skills, we invite you to join our team and contribute to the success of our innovative projects.

Nice to have

bullet icon

N/A

Other
seniority icon

Languages

English: B2 Upper Intermediate

seniority icon

Seniority

Senior

Similar Jobs

Looks like we're out of matches

Set up an alert and we'll send you similar jobs the moment they appear!

Similar Skill Jobs

Looks like we're out of matches

Set up an alert and we'll send you similar jobs the moment they appear!

Jobs in Chennai, Tamil Nadu, India

Looks like we're out of matches

Set up an alert and we'll send you similar jobs the moment they appear!

Similar Category Jobs

Looks like we're out of matches

Set up an alert and we'll send you similar jobs the moment they appear!

About The Company

Empower your future with Luxoft: Innovate, thrive and grow in a software-defined world.Luxoft works with companies from all over the globe and offers opportunities for candidates anywhere in the world.

Bengaluru, Karnataka, India (On-Site)

Bengaluru, Karnataka, India (On-Site)

Chennai, Tamil Nadu, India (On-Site)

Gurugram, India (On-Site)

Gurugram, India (On-Site)

Chennai, Tamil Nadu, India (On-Site)

Gurugram, India (On-Site)

Riyadh, Riyadh Province, Saudi Arabia (On-Site)

Irvine, California, United States (On-Site)

Pune, Maharashtra, India (On-Site)

View All Jobs

Get notified when new jobs are added by luxsoft

Level Up Your Career in Game Development!

Transform Your Passion into Profession with Our Comprehensive Courses for Aspiring Game Developers.

Job Common Plug